There are five designated Dark Sky Discovery Sites within the AONB – all of which have parking and plenty of room to observe the sky: Beacon Fell Country Park, Gisburn Forest Hub, Slaidburn Village Car Park, Crook o’ Lune Picnic Site and at a private business who have gone through the accreditation themselves -Ĭlerk Laithe Lodge Guest House in Newton in Bowland. The winter months, when the nights are longer and the skies are darker, tend to be the best time to stargaze, but events like the Perseids meteor shower in mid-August, when observers can see dozens of shooting stars an hour, also make a real celestial spectacle. Many of the earth’s companion planets in the solar system: Venus, Mars, Jupiter, Saturn and Uranus are visible at various times of year, as are more distant objects like the Orion Nebula and the Great Galaxy in Andromeda. Most of these groups of stars or ‘constellations’ were identified and named by the world’s earliest astronomers from Ancient Greece or Babylon.Īnd as well as these often rather tenuous characters in the sky, there’s a whole host of other heavenly objects to look at. This is the domain of Pegasus, the winged horse, Taurus, the bull, Orion, the hunter, and Andromeda, a beautiful princess. On a clear cloud-free and ideally moonless night, the skies above the Forest become home to all manner of legendary figures and mythical beasts. The night skies over Bowland have recently been recognized as some of the darkest in England and granted official status as Dark Sky Discovery Sites. More than half of Britain’s remaining dark skies are in National Parks or Areas of Outstanding Natural Beauty and the Forest of Bowland is among them.ĭOWNLOAD A COPY OF OUR DARK SKIES LEAFLET In 21st Century Britain, many town and city dwellers may never have seen the Milky Way – our home galaxy – and will only catch the faintest glimpse of a handful of the brightest stars.īut there is an antidote to the bright lights of big city living – an oasis of velvety darkness where even the faintest stars in the firmament reveal themselves in all their sparkling glory. Light pollution is creeping into almost every corner of the UK, diluting the pitch blackness of night and obscuring the stars for much of the population.
